Conventional Waterproofing Techniques



Typical waterproofing approaches have been utilized for centuries, relying on tried and true strategies and materials to protect frameworks from water damages. One of the earliest methods includes making use of clay, which, when compressed, develops an all-natural barrier against dampness. Furthermore, asphalt, a sticky, black product originated from petroleum, has actually been utilized for its waterproof properties, frequently applied to roof coverings and foundations.Another technique includes the application of lime-based plasters, which offer a breathable layer that permits moisture to escape while stopping water ingress. Thatch roof covering, a typical technique still seen in some societies, offers outstanding waterproofing because of its snugly packed straw layers.Moreover, making use of rock and brick has actually been popular, as these products are naturally resistant to water when appropriately set up. Overall, conventional waterproofing approaches highlight the significance of picking suitable products and building practices to improve toughness versus water invasion.

Products Made Use Of in Waterproofing





The performance of waterproofing remedies greatly depends on the materials utilized in their application. Numerous products are used to create obstacles versus water ingress, each with one-of-a-kind properties matched for different settings. Typically made use of materials include membranes, coatings, and sealants.Liquid-applied membrane layers, typically made from polyurethane or acrylic, form a smooth barrier that adjusts to complicated surfaces. Sheet membranes, commonly built from rubber or thermoplastic, deal toughness and are optimal for larger areas. Furthermore, cementitious waterproofing products, composed of cementitious substances, supply superb bond and flexibility.Sealants made from silicone or polyurethane are important for joints and seams, guaranteeing extensive security. Furthermore, innovative products, such as geo-composite membranes, incorporate several features, enhancing efficiency. On the whole, the selection of waterproofing products is essential in attaining resilient and efficient water resistance, customized to particular task requirements and environmental conditions.

Residential Waterproofing Solutions



Several property owners encounter obstacles with dampness invasion, making efficient domestic waterproofing options important. Various approaches exist to address this concern, including exterior and interior waterproofing systems. Inside solutions often include the application of sealers and layers to cellar wall surfaces, which aid stop water infiltration. Exterior techniques generally include the installation of water drainage systems and water resistant membranes that draw away water far from the foundation.Additionally, property owners may consider sump pumps to get rid of water buildup and dehumidifiers to control moisture levels. Correct grading and the usage of gutters additionally play an important function in taking care of water circulation around the home. By implementing these methods, homeowners can considerably reduce the threat of water damages and mold and mildew growth, ensuring a dry and risk-free living atmosphere.
